Henri Rostand, the mild mannered accountant for the influential French industrialist corporation, Roche Enterprises is found floating in the Seine with a bullet in the head. Inspector Pinaud thinks of it as a routine murder until he discovers a link between Rostand and Roche Enterprises. His investigation brings him head to head with the ruthless industrialist, Roche, who will stop at nothing to hide the truth about the murder.
